Python swallows woman whole in Indonesia


MAKASSAR (AFP): A woman has been found dead inside the belly of a snake after it swallowed her whole in central Indonesia, a local official said Saturday (June 8).

The husband of 45-year-old Farida and residents of Kalempang village in South Sulawesi province discovered her on Friday (June 7) inside the reticulated python, which measured around 5m.
